Arif Habib Consortium Eyes Full PIA Ownership With 25pc Stake Bid

The Arif Habib-led consortium has formally notified the Privatisation Commission of its intent to acquire the remaining 25 per cent stake in Pakistan International Airlines, signalling a move toward complete private ownership of the national carrier. The notification marks a significant procedural step in the ongoing PIA privatisation process, which has been a centrepiece of the government's broader divestment agenda under its economic reform programme.

The consortium had previously emerged as the successful bidder in the earlier privatisation round, and this latest notification suggests the group is now seeking to consolidate its position by absorbing the residual government shareholding. The move would, if completed, effectively transfer full operational and strategic control of PIA to private hands.

The Privatisation Commission is expected to evaluate the notification and determine the procedural pathway for the acquisition, including any regulatory approvals required under the applicable privatisation framework. PIA's privatisation has been a longstanding condition tied to Pakistan's engagement with the International Monetary Fund, which has pressed Islamabad to reduce state exposure to loss-making public enterprises.

The airline has faced years of financial distress, operational inefficiency, and mounting debt, making its full privatisation a high-stakes test of the government's credibility on structural reform. Completion of the acquisition would represent one of the most consequential asset transfers in Pakistan's privatisation history.
